Location and Transport: Ideally situated near the historic town of Aigre, this property offers the perfect balance between rural tranquility and accessibility.
Local Life: Aigre is a vibrant town renowned for its traditional weekly market, the prestigious Gautier Cognac house, supermarkets, artisan bakeries, and riverside restaurants.
Train: Just 10 minutes from Luxé train station and 30 minutes from Angoulême, where the TGV high-speed train connects you to Paris in under 2 hours or Bordeaux in 35 minutes.
Road and Air: Excellent access via the N10. Perfectly positioned for international travel via the airports of Poitiers, Limoges, and Bordeaux.
